best in oklahoma for video poker
(Updated: May 27, 2017)
Overall rating
 
3.4
Slots
 
5.0
Table Games
 
N/A
Customer Service
 
3.0
Player's Club
 
3.0
Gaming Atmosphere
 
3.0
Amenities or Hotel
 
N/A
Food & Drink
 
3.0
I can't speak for the Class II slot machines, which I never play. (What's the fun of just pressing a button with no skill involved?) But Buffalo Run has the very best odds on video poker, Class III [RPG] machines with 99.5% payouts! I've found no other casino in Oklahoma which pays 9 on a full house, 6 on a flush. And you get these optimal odds, whether you play quarters or dollars. So I can afford to play max bet, which offers 4000 on a full house (vs 250 payout on 1). At max quarters, that pays $1,000 - conveniently just below the threshold for IRS reporting. By comparison, the nearby downstream pays only 8/5, and the Winstar pays an atrocious 7/5. The Grand pays 8/6, but only on dollar bets. If you are a savvy gambler whos attention to the pay tables, video poker at Buffalo Run is your very best bet.

The loosest slots?
(Updated: July 14, 2015)
Overall rating
 
3.2
Slots
 
2.0
Table Games
 
N/A
Customer Service
 
4.0
Player's Club
 
3.0
Gaming Atmosphere
 
4.0
Amenities or Hotel
 
N/A
Food & Drink
 
3.0
Buffalo Run has been running a big TV and radio promotional; program, touting the "loosest slots in Arkansas, Missouri and Oklahoma". They also are pushing the idea that since they haven't built a new casino building, they are "In the Black and paying Back".

My wife and I, three - four years ago, went to Buffalo Run quite regularly, and did as well on the slots as we did anywhere else, and better, I think, on average, than most other Native American casinos in the area.

We stopped going there however when we seemed to stop having any luck on the slots. A couple weeks ago, we returned based on their big advertising promotion, to see if we noticed any difference in the slots. We went through our night's 'budget' in short order, and seemingly the slots were just as hungry, or maybe even moreso, than they had been when we stopped going there a few years ago.

I do think the atmosphere there is fine, and the employees as responsive as most any other casino. The player's club is average, and we fine nothing particularly good or bad about the food and drink services.

For my money however, (and that is the money I am most concerned about!) I will not be going back anytime soon. There are other casinos, newer and nicer, with equal or better food, drink and customer services, closer to my home where I seem to at least have some luck during an evening on at least one or two slot machines, even if not winning any big jackpots. I know I can play longer on my money at these other casinos, than I can at Buffalo Run on that same amount of money. And since slots are the only thing I play, that is the bottom line.
